
For as many as are led by the Spirit of God, they are the sons of God.
Romans 8:14
Paul tells us that children of God are to be led by the Spirit of God. Christians are His children and so we must develop in our awareness of the Spirit’s presence in our lives.
As we continue on in our journey I encourage you to take time to read the book of Acts. Make note of every time the early church references the Holy Spirit. You will find phrases like “the Holy Spirit said this” or “the Holy Spirit sent them out”. We should be just as aware of His presence in direction in our lives today.
There are a lot of tragedies that could have been avoided if someone had been sensitive to what the Holy Spirit was directing. We will not be aware of His leadings f we do not put in the time necessary to develop our relationship with Him.
The Holy Spirit will always lead us through our spirits. As we develop our awareness of our inner man we will become more aware of His presence within us.
But ye, beloved, building up yourselves on your most holy faith, praying in the Holy Ghost.
Jude 20
There are things we can do to make ourselves more aware of the Holy Spirit’s presence in our lives. One of these is praying in the spirit as He gives the utterance.
God places responsibility on us to do what is necessary to grow spiritually. The Holy Spirit will help us if we are doing our part. He will never force us into anything because God wants us to willingly follow Him.
The Holy Spirit has never made any man, woman, or child receive salvation. He has never forced or tricked a single person into following His leading. We have a freewill and are responsible for our decisions to either pursue His presence or not to.
But I keep under my body, and bring it into subjection: lest that by any means, when I have preached to others, I myself should be a castaway.
1 Corinthians 9:27
We have been given a freewill. It is our choice to either discipline our flesh to pursue God or not to pursue Him.
The Church has been largely void of power today because so many of us have limited our lives to what we are able to perceive with our five physical senses. We must stop limiting ourselves to the natural realm!
Likewise the Spirit also helpeth our infirmities: for we know not what we should pray for as we ought: but the Spirit itself maketh intercession for us with groanings which cannot be uttered.
Romans 8:26
Paul told his readers that the Holy Spirit would help them in prayer. He will help us as well but we must train ourselves to look to Him. The Holy Spirit will help us as we yield to Him in this type of prayer which many refer to as “praying in the Spirit”.
As we yield to the Holy Spirit He will provide us utterance to pray out mysteries unknown to us. These mysteries will give birth to revelation knowledge.
For he that speaketh in an unknown tongue speaketh not unto men, but unto God: for no man understandeth him; howbeit in the spirit he speaketh mysteries.
1 Corinthians 14:2
The more time we give to yielding to the Spirit in prayer by speaking out the utterances He provides, the more we will find ourselves understanding the mysteries of God’s kingdom. This is one of the greatest things we can do to increase our spiritual sensitivity.
